Bladder Cancer Market Size, Share, and Competitive Landscape

The Bladder Cancer Market Size reflects substantial investment and competitive activity across diagnostics, therapeutics, and supportive care solutions. In many developed regions, including North America and Europe, the market benefits from advanced healthcare infrastructure, strong research ecosystems, and early adoption of innovative technologies. The United States, in particular, holds a significant share due to its high incidence of bladder cancer, robust clinical trial activity, and extensive oncology research networks. Regional markets in Asia-Pacific and Latin America are also expanding rapidly as healthcare access improves and screening efforts become more widespread. Regulatory support, reimbursement frameworks, and increasing public awareness are helping reduce disparities in care and expand patient access to novel diagnostics and treatments.

Competitive dynamics in the Bladder Cancer Market Size are shaped by both established pharmaceutical companies and innovative biotech firms. Leading players are investing heavily in research and development to bring forward more effective immunotherapies, targeted agents, and biomarker-driven diagnostics that can differentiate treatment pathways based on individual tumor profiles. Partnerships with academic research centers, as well as strategic alliances across the biopharmaceutical value chain, are helping accelerate product development and clinical validation. Competitive advantage is increasingly tied to innovation, clinical evidence, and the ability to deliver personalized oncology solutions. Additionally, companies are focusing on patient support programs, treatment adherence platforms, and value-based care initiatives that enhance patient outcomes and strengthen market positioning. As the bladder cancer market continues to grow, innovation and strategic collaboration will remain central to competitive success.
